Stickles Ln - streets of Port Byron (New York).
Explore "Stickles Ln" on the map of Port Byron in street view mode
Click on the buttons below to display the map of Stickles Ln, Port Byron, United States
Search street by name:
Tags:
Stickles Ln on the map of Port Byron,
Port Byron satellite view, Port Byron street view.